summaryrefslogtreecommitdiffstats
path: root/src/python
Commit message (Collapse)AuthorAgeFilesLines
* Adding new Python API 'is_func_iso2'.Alan Mishchenko2015-07-111-1/+15
|
* Adding new Python API 'is_func_iso'.Alan Mishchenko2015-07-111-0/+14
|
* Adding new Python API 'co_supp'.Alan Mishchenko2015-07-061-0/+26
|
* pyabc: handle a few corner casesBaruch Sterin2014-10-281-2/+8
|
* pyabc package script: don't package mercurial repositoriesBaruch Sterin2014-06-141-0/+3
|
* pyabc packaging script: also package shared objectsBaruch Sterin2014-06-141-1/+1
|
* add an option to the pyabc packaging scriptsBaruch Sterin2014-06-101-2/+7
|
* minor changes to pyabc install scriptBaruch Sterin2014-06-091-2/+14
|
* Ternary simulation for multi-output miters.Alan Mishchenko2014-03-281-0/+10
|
* Adding Python API n_area() to report area after standard cell mapping.Alan Mishchenko2014-02-171-0/+14
|
* pyabc changes for HWMCC13Baruch Sterin2013-10-085-46/+150
|
* Compiler warning.Alan Mishchenko2013-10-051-1/+1
|
* Compiler errors in the Python interface code...Alan Mishchenko2013-10-031-2/+2
|
* Added Python API status_get_vector() similar to cex_get_vector().Alan Mishchenko2013-09-041-1/+1
|
* Added Python API status_get_vector() similar to cex_get_vector().Alan Mishchenko2013-09-041-1/+1
|
* Added Python API status_get_vector() similar to cex_get_vector().Alan Mishchenko2013-09-041-0/+32
|
* fix pyabc to link correctly on some linux version, fixing problem caused by ↵Baruch Sterin2013-06-181-0/+1
| | | | the changeset named: Suggested changes to counting time in Abc_Clock()
* Moves the code of create_abc_array to line 724.Alan Mishchenko2013-04-171-4/+7
|
* Adding command &filter_equiv to filter candidate equivalence classes using ↵Alan Mishchenko2013-04-171-0/+22
| | | | indexes of disproved POs after handling SRM as a multi-output miter.
* Modified Python API iso_eq_classes to be eq_classes.Alan Mishchenko2013-03-091-2/+2
|
* pyabc: allow returning large result from sub processesBaruch Sterin2013-01-302-11/+83
|
* pyabc: fix _cex_put to not call Abc_CexDup() twiceBaruch Sterin2013-01-251-20/+20
|
* pyabc: deal better with null counter examples and remove special case handlingBaruch Sterin2013-01-251-19/+7
|
* Added new Python API is_const_po( int iPoNum ), which returns 0/1 if current ↵Alan Mishchenko2013-01-251-0/+7
| | | | network is an AIG and the given PO has const 0/1 function.
* Enabled detecting CEXes in multiple POs without stopping (sim3 -a).Alan Mishchenko2013-01-231-0/+2
|
* Updated Python code to reflect change in include files.Alan Mishchenko2012-07-092-3/+3
|
* pyabc: minor fixes to make API changes workBaruch Sterin2012-04-201-1/+3
|
* Added Python APIs for node/level counts.Alan Mishchenko2012-04-201-3/+29
|
* pyabc: python 2.6 compatibility fix for previous commit (which silenced ↵Baruch Sterin2012-02-231-1/+1
| | | | warnings)
* pyabc: silenced warnings in gccBaruch Sterin2012-02-232-7/+23
|
* pyabc: added a function pyabc.iso_eq_classes() that retrieves the results of ↵Baruch Sterin2012-02-231-0/+40
| | | | the "&iso" command
* pyabc: replace 'bool' with 'int' as it was removed from the rest of ABCBaruch Sterin2012-02-111-8/+8
|
* pyabc: adapt build to recent changes in the rest of ABCBaruch Sterin2012-01-212-22/+3
|
* pyabc: rearrange files and locationsBaruch Sterin2011-10-244-5/+114
|
* pyabc: fix command line parser in reachx_cmx.py and abcpy_test.pyBaruch Sterin2011-10-241-1/+1
|
* pyabc: fix callbacks into python to work correctly by moving to ↵Baruch Sterin2011-09-291-17/+23
| | | | PyGILEState_Ensure/Release APIs
* pyabc: fix indentation in pyabc.iBaruch Sterin2011-10-241-12/+12
|
* added support for getting a cex vectorBaruch Sterin2011-08-021-1/+50
|
* Added 'src/mem' as an additition include directory in Python interface.Alan Mishchenko2011-03-041-0/+1
|
* fixes to pyabc kill mechanismBaruch Sterin2011-02-273-97/+731
|
* 1. Replace system() with a function that responds to SIGINT. 2. Add ↵Baruch Sterin2011-02-012-29/+42
| | | | functions to cleanup temporary files on SIGINT. 3. Fix bugs related to signal handling.
* pyabc: reorganize supporting python scriptsBaruch Sterin2011-01-134-1/+477
|
* pyabc: make the SIGINT signal handler clean up by sending SIGINT to child ↵Baruch Sterin2011-01-132-61/+113
| | | | processes registered by the python code. Also provide functions to block SIGINT and unblock it, to allow for critical sections where signals are blocked
* initial commit of public abcAlan Mishchenko2010-11-017-0/+746